WebThe zygote undergoes mitosis to form a multicellular, diploid sporophyte, the frond-bearing structure that we usually think of as a fern. On the sporophyte, specialized structures called sporangia form, and inside of them, haploid cells (spores, 1n) are formed by meiosis. The spores are released and can germinate, starting the cycle over again. Web7 Apr 2024 · The diploid generation is the sporophyte that produces the spores. WebIn seed plants, the evolutionary trend led to a dominant sporophyte generation, in which the larger and more ecologically significant generation for a species is the diploid plant. At the same time, the trend led to a reduction in the size of the gametophyte, from a conspicuous structure to a microscopic cluster of cells enclosed in the tissues of the sporophyte.
